Analysis
Argentina recorded 1.33 million current LCU per person for tax revenue (current lcu), per capita in 2024. That is the highest value across all 35 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 217.7% on the previous year and up 9,829.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, tax revenue (current lcu), per capita in Argentina peaked at 1.33 million current LCU per person in 2024 and was at its lowest, 101.81 current LCU per person, in 1990.
That places Argentina 13th out of 157 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top 10%.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Tax revenue (current LCU), per capita in Argentina, year by year
| Year | current LCU per person |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1990 | 101.81 current LCU per person | — |
| 1991 | 272.64 current LCU per person | +167.8% |
| 1992 | 373.18 current LCU per person | +36.9% |
| 1993 | 555.04 current LCU per person | +48.7% |
| 1994 | 604.41 current LCU per person | +8.9% |
| 1995 | 592.61 current LCU per person | -2.0% |
| 1996 | 626.22 current LCU per person | +5.7% |
| 1997 | 707.96 current LCU per person | +13.1% |
| 1998 | 742.22 current LCU per person | +4.8% |
| 1999 | 699.36 current LCU per person | -5.8% |
| 2000 | 734.88 current LCU per person | +5.1% |
| 2001 | 665.94 current LCU per person | -9.4% |
| 2002 | 807.07 current LCU per person | +21.2% |
| 2003 | 1,225 current LCU per person | +51.8% |
| 2004 | 1,637 current LCU per person | +33.7% |
| 2005 | 1,946 current LCU per person | +18.9% |
| 2006 | 2,327 current LCU per person | +19.6% |
| 2007 | 2,790 current LCU per person | +19.9% |
| 2008 | 3,788 current LCU per person | +35.7% |
| 2009 | 3,782 current LCU per person | -0.1% |
| 2010 | 5,173 current LCU per person | +36.8% |
| 2011 | 6,612 current LCU per person | +27.8% |
| 2012 | 8,104 current LCU per person | +22.6% |
| 2013 | 9,792 current LCU per person | +20.8% |
| 2014 | 13,422 current LCU per person | +37.1% |
| 2015 | 16,896 current LCU per person | +25.9% |
| 2016 | 22,674 current LCU per person | +34.2% |
| 2017 | 26,331 current LCU per person | +16.1% |
| 2018 | 32,331 current LCU per person | +22.8% |
| 2019 | 49,815 current LCU per person | +54.1% |
| 2020 | 64,473 current LCU per person | +29.4% |
| 2021 | 115,680 current LCU per person | +79.4% |
| 2022 | 201,787 current LCU per person | +74.4% |
| 2023 | 419,514 current LCU per person | +107.9% |
| 2024 | 1.33 million current LCU per person | +217.7% |

How this figure is calculated
Tax revenue (current LCU)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Tax revenue (current LCU)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Tax revenue Government Finance Statistics Yearbook and data files, International Monetary Fund (IMF)
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
